Python Dersleri – 3

KOŞUL DURUMLARI

1.Boolean Expressions

  • “True” , “False”
  • x != y  ————> x y’ye eşit değildir.
  • x > y ————-> x y’den büyüktür
  • x < y ————-> x y’den küçüktür
  • x >= y ————-> x y’den büyüktür ya da x y’ye eşittir.
  • x <= y ————-> x y’den küçüktür ya da x y’ye eşittir.
  • x == y ————–> x  y’ye eşit ise

2.Logical Operators

  • and , or , not
  • and ———–>  x >0  and x < 10   ————–> x 0dan büyükse ve 10 dan küçükse …
  • or ———–>  x % 2 == 0  or x % 3 == 0   ————–> x ‘in mod 2 si ya da mod 3ü 0 a eşitse …

3.Conditional Execution

if x<0:

print (“admin”)

 

4.Alternative Execution

else :

print (“admin”)

5.Chained Conditions

if x<y :

print(” x y’den küçüktür.)

elif x>y :

print(” x y’den büyüktür.)

else:

print(“x y’ye eşittir.)

 

6. Nested Conditions ( iç içe fonksiyonlar )

if x == y :

print(” x y’ye eşittir.”)

else:

if x<y:

print ( “x y’den küçüktür”)

else:

print(“x y’den büyüktür.”)

 

Örnek :

x=6

y=2

x >= 2 and x/y >2

——-> Çıktı : True

 

Örnek :

x = 6

y = 0

x >= 2 and x/y > 2

——–> Error : 0 a bölünme hatası

 

 

 

 

 

Please follow and like us: